Posted: Sat Apr 24, 2010 1:23 am Post subject: ready to install XBMC Installer Deluxe but wait whats this
I am ready to install XBMC Installer Deluxe made the ISO disk but now I have questions. There is to many choices. One click what kind of boot is a good idea and where should I install XBMC I used SID 5 earlier and it went really well after some help with xplorer360 from wes.

Since xbox is going to stop offering live for the xbox 1 you can do a duel boot XBMC/SID dash and you will want to install to the E drive.
If the xbox is already modded you might want to take the time to download AID and use its softmod install option for this one.

One other question since you have a great amount of experience with this. What skin do you suggest for overall performance. The reason I am asking that I read on other forums that certain skins don't work well with xbox 1.
I have a 47" HD TV I do have Monster component cables all a pair of Pcyclone cables not sure what best on these yet. I want to watch old tv torrents and movie DVD rips.

For the most part XBMC runs best with the stock PM3 or PM3 HD skin.
All the others seemed to give me longer load times but you can try a few and see if they have fixed any of the issues i had.
